Meena Chintapalli, MD, FAAP, maintains her own private pediatric practice located in San Antonio Texas. Her practice derived from, Dr. Chintapalli's strong desire to grow her business into a group of providers; ultimately helping more children in the area. Dr. Chintapalli became passionate about asthma treatment and control as well as developmental and behavioral pediatrics. Her expertise in behavioral pediatrics led her to incorporate her findings into her treatment plans knowledge of experiential neuro-developmental organization of the brain. She educates her patients on brain development and adaptive bio-social behaviors through counseling and guidance with the hopes that her techniques will help bring out the natural genius of every child. Certified by the American Board of Pediatrics, Dr. Chintapalli speaks internationally for educational purposes; as well as being involved with medical mission trips around the globe. For all of her outstanding achievements and passion in the field, Dr. Chintapalli has been honored with many awards of excellence and has been given the prestigious title of Fellow of the American Academy of Peditrics.
